Wilson Airport is an in , . It has flights to many regional airports in Kenya while Nairobi's main airport, , serves domestic and many international destinations. is situated 3 km east of Ngei Primary School.

is a tourist village in Langata, , in Kenya. Bomas interpreted to mean displays traditional villages belonging to the several Kenyan tribes. is situated 2½ km southwest of Ngei Primary School.
